The Opportunity
Mosaic Recruitment is delighted to be working with an established and highly regarded professional services organisation in Hertford to recruit an experienced Family Law Executive on a part-time basis. This is a 12-month maternity cover position, working approximately 17.5-20 hours per week, and would suit someone with previous experience supporting a busy Family Law department.
You will work closely with Partners and Fee Earners, providing comprehensive administrative, secretarial and case support. This is a varied role requiring excellent organisation, attention to detail and the ability to manage sensitive and confidential information with complete professionalism.
The successful candidate will be joining a friendly, supportive team with a strong focus on delivering an exceptional level of client care.
